Preparation Checklist for a Smoother Move

Even when you book help, a little preparation can make your packing and unpacking day much easier. The goal is not to do all the work yourself, but to make sure the team can work efficiently and place things in the right order.

Before packing day
  • Separate items you want to keep with you personally, such as passports, medications, and essential documents
  • Let the team know about fragile, bulky, or awkward items in advance
  • Clear pathways where possible to allow easier movement through rooms and hallways
  • Decide whether you want full packing or only selected rooms packed
  • Set aside belongings you do not want packed
  • Arrange parking or building access details if required

It also helps to identify the items you will need first after arriving at the new property. These often include toiletries, clean clothes, bedding, chargers, tea or coffee essentials, basic kitchenware, and important paperwork. If those items are packed separately or marked clearly, settling in becomes much easier.

Pricing Factors to Expect

Customers often want an upfront understanding of what affects the cost of packing and unpacking services, even when no exact prices are given. While every move is different, a few common factors usually influence the quote or estimate.

  • Size of the property: A studio flat will require less time and fewer materials than a large family home or office.
  • Amount of contents: The more items you have, the longer packing and unpacking will take.
  • Type of belongings: Fragile, valuable, or specialist items may need extra care and materials.
  • Access conditions: Stairs, narrow hallways, parking distance, and lift availability can all affect the work involved.
  • Full or partial service: Packing an entire home takes longer than focusing on only selected rooms.
  • Timing and scheduling: Last-minute moves or time-sensitive arrangements may require more coordination.

If you are comparing options, it is sensible to ask what is included in the service and what materials are provided. That way, you can understand the overall value and choose the level of support that fits your move.

FAQs About Packing and Unpacking Services in Towerhill

Can I book packing only, without unpacking?

Yes. Many customers only want help with the packing stage, especially if they plan to unpack at their own pace later. Packing-only support is useful when you want the move prepared professionally but prefer to settle in gradually.

Can you help unpack just the essentials?

Yes. Some people do not need every box opened on the first day. It is common to unpack essentials first, such as kitchen basics, bedding, and bathroom items, then leave the rest for later.

Do I need to buy my own packing materials?

That depends on the service arrangement. Some teams supply materials as part of the job, while others can work with materials you already have. It is best to ask in advance so you know what will be provided.

How long does packing usually take?

The time needed depends on the size of the property, how many belongings you have, and whether fragile items or specialist equipment are involved. A small flat may take far less time than a full family house or office.

Can the team pack fragile and awkward items?

Yes. Glassware, mirrors, ornaments, lamps, artwork, and electronics are commonly included. If you have any particularly delicate or unusual items, mention them early so the right materials and handling can be used.

Is unpacking available for office moves too?

Yes. Businesses often use unpacking support to get files, desks, equipment, and supplies placed in the correct areas quickly. It helps staff return to work with less disruption.

What should I keep with me personally?

Important documents, medication, valuables, keys, chargers, and immediate-use items are usually best kept separately. That way, you can access them quickly without opening several boxes.
